Doctoral Research Conference 2023

On 14 June 2023, our community gathered together for the Doctoral Research Conference, to celebrate the excellence and diversity in doctoral research at the University.

We enjoyed an amazing range of presentations from students, inspiring keynote presentations on research integrity from Dr Etienne Roesch and on research communication from Pete Castle and student-made films, posters, image and object exhibitions amongst others.

It was a fascinating and engaging afternoon, providing an opportunity to gain an appreciation of the great things doctoral researchers are doing across a wide range of disciplines. We would like to thank everyone who was involved and to congratulate the prize winners. A full recording of the conference is available to view in Blackboard.
